Chapter 1 Shanghai, you cannot become advanced

Shanghai is now becoming more and more difficult for people to live on From food, clothing, housing and transportation to eating, drinking, whoring and gambling are the most expensive in China Shanghai does not welcome outsiders, nor does Shanghainese Shanghai only welcomes one kind of people, that is, those with money You are not welcome in Shanghai unless you come to buy something But none of us have RMB on us You are not welcome in Shanghai, the World Expo is really amazing Rich people from all over the world come to meet ——The Circus on the Top Floor "Shanghai Doesn't Welcome You"

When Shanghai's local band "The Circus on the Top Floor" blew the audience with the song "Shanghai Doesn't Welcome You" at the premiere ceremony of "Rock Shanghai" at MAO Live House on November 28, 2009, Xiao Zhengyi (pseudonym) He was having dinner with his 11th blind date at KEE, a private club at No. 796 Middle Huaihai Road, but Xiao Zhengyi didn’t enjoy it. He stared at the piece of flounder steamed with mushrooms, olive oil and lemon juice, and smiled wryly. Directly opposite him, sat the girl and her mother, who were from Shanghai, eating fish gracefully, as if they had received strict training in western food etiquette.

"Mr. Xiao, how many houses do you have? Is it a villa or an apartment building? Do you have a Shanghai household registration? Do you have a nanny at home? Allah can't be a mother..." Same thing, same little difference.For more than half a year, enthusiastic colleagues and friends introduced many beautiful Shanghai girls to 33-year-old Xiao Zhengyi, but they and their relatives and friends paid more attention to Xiao Zhengyi's ability to make money than he was interested in him.I can't laugh or cry. Xiao Zhengyi, a native of Nanjing, graduated from the Department of Software Technology and Computer Theory of the Technical University of Berlin in 2001 with a master's degree, and then worked in the German mobile software company Cellity for nearly four years.Because he still couldn't let go of his dream of starting a business, he quit his enviable job, sold his house and car, took 85,000 euros in savings, and returned to China with nothing to pack, and chose Shanghai to start a business.

In 2005, Xiao Zhengyi devoted all his resources to founding an industrial application software development company in Zhangjiang Hi-Tech Park.At the beginning of his business, in addition to running between government departments, investment companies and related units every day, Xiao Zhengyi also had to deal with frequent job-hopping and leave requests from Shanghai employees.Most of the time, it is the applicant who sees that the company is so small, turns around and leaves.Talent is hard to find, this is his real experience after being the boss for half a year. At first, Xiao Zhengyi had a very good engineer, a capable guy from Shanghai, but his girlfriend hoped that he could work in a Fortune 500 foreign-funded company and go in and out of high-end office buildings every day.Well-dressed and well-paid, because it feels more decent, and Xiao Zhengyi’s small company, when the name is mentioned, the relatives shake their heads and say they don’t know-can the income be good?Can the future have a future?Are you incapable of getting into a big company?So I kept threatening and luring me with phone calls and text messages every now and then.Xiao Zhengyi worked hard and finally stabilized his outstanding employees with salary increases and future promotions.Unexpectedly, two months later, the boy's girlfriend flirted with him, which made Xiao Zhengyi very embarrassed, so he had no choice but to persuade his employees to go home and get their love back.

But what made Xiao Zhengyi even more headache was the problem of funds.The annual office rent is 240,000 yuan, and the employee salary is 360,000 yuan, not including water and electricity, property and office consumables.To develop a good software with high market acceptance, a lot of manpower and financial resources are required in the early stage, but for a small company that has just started, Xiao Zhengyi knows that he can't afford to wait, so he is a little anxious.He went in and out of government departments more diligently to seek policy-based financial assistance for overseas returnees to start a business, but he only saw a lot of policy-related funds being invested in a certain state-owned enterprise, spending a lot of money, and a single investment reached 20 to 30 million.Xiao Zhengyi knew in his heart that 20 million yuan would be of great help to small and medium-sized enterprises like him, and could help small enterprises overcome the hurdle of life and death.But Shanghai's money always seems to be more willing to add icing on the cake than give it a helping hand.

Under the predicament of lack of people and money, Xiao Zhengyi's entrepreneurial dream was finally completely shattered after struggling for two years. He was depressed for more than a month, but soon a headhunting company approached Xiao Zhengyi and recommended him the position of technical director of the Shanghai branch of a Fortune 500 IT company.After several rounds of interviews, Xiao Zhengyi successfully got the offer with an annual salary of 500,000.So, he changed from a physically and mentally exhausted entrepreneur to a senior wage earner, but he was still physically and mentally exhausted.

In the new company, although Xiao Zhengyi does not have to work overtime every day, no one even cares about being late for work.But this kind of "small pine and small casual" also means that he has no clear work and rest time.If there is a new development project, it is common for him to work until one or two o'clock in the morning of the next day; when he has a cervical spondylosis and is lying on the bed with a collar on, he needs to remotely control the details of technology research and development; it is rare to take annual leave, Vienna at 2 am He was woken up by a work call in Shanghai, but when he saw the number displayed on the phone, Xiao Zhengyi immediately and subconsciously "tuned" his nerves to work.

His parents far away in Nanjing are old and often call Xiao Zhengyi to pay more attention to rest, but he is also quite helpless: "Escape so far, and he is still chased by work. Many foreign customers can really take care of work when they are on vacation. Throw it away, but I can't do it." Xiao Zhengyi attributed it to the environment: "When everyone in this city is in a hurry, it becomes inappropriate to stroll all the way to see the scenery." Too much work makes people depressed. I don't know when, Xiao Zhengyi's left eye frequently appeared large white spots, like lightning, and he felt that he was going blind.He regrets that his body will never be as strong as his will.

One day, after working overtime until early in the morning, when he got home, Xiao Zhengyi could not see clearly in his left eye. The middle-aged man sat down on the ground without turning on the light, and buried his head in his arms.There is nothing in this rental house in Shanghai that can comfort him.At this time, he suddenly remembered inexplicably the reunion of high school classmates not long ago, and all the people who came were Nanjing people who had struggled in Shanghai for many years. This is an AA "pure friendship" party.It is very in line with the habits of Shanghainese, and Xiao Zhengyi is not disgusted.It's just that several people haven't seen each other for many years, which makes him feel a little strange.One of them was wearing gold-rimmed glasses and a neat suit, talking loudly.When someone asked him about his specific job, he just said that I was an investor, and he didn't want to continue this topic.Some people also took the initiative to talk about their work, saying that they are doing HR, and they often travel to and from South America and the Middle East, and they are usually very busy.

Eight people ate 930 yuan. Dividing 930 by 8 is inexhaustible. As a result, when paying the bill, someone also took out the coins, and one coin fell on the ground and rolled a long way.The waiter was a Shandong girl in her early 20s, very dedicated, with a blushing face, squatting on the ground to help them find that yellow fifty-cent coin that rolled far away... A few days later, Xiao Zhengyi learned from one of his classmates that the investment classmate at the party was a salesman in the credit card department of China Merchants Bank, and his main job was to sell credit cards; the one who often went to South America and the Middle East to do "human resources management" Yes, he is actually an unlicensed tour guide leading the way, fighting guerrillas everywhere.

Shanghai has turned the former green youth into a pragmatic middle-aged uncle, trying his best to disguise the "patches" in his life. That night, Xiao Zhengyi was in a flood of thoughts. The next day, he decided to settle down his life as soon as possible, start a family, and have a child.Therefore, Xiao Zhengyi, who has already passed the 30-year-old mark and has never been in a serious relationship, accepted the kindness of his relatives, friends and colleagues, shuttled through many blind date parties, and met all kinds of girls. "Sorry, I don't have a house in Shanghai, temporarily." Xiao Zhengyi put down his knife and fork, and calmly looked at the mother and daughter in front of him. The girl's name is Li Man (pseudonym), Xiao Zhengyi's 11th blind date, and also a returnee.Two years ago, Li Man, a girl from Shanghai, returned home after studying for a year of accounting at Manchester University of Technology.In this year alone, his parents spent 300,000 yuan on Li Man. Li Man, who was born in 1983, is well-dressed. She even carries LV speedy30 in her English training class. Fashionable new models from top famous brands have almost become her "mantra".In the past two years after returning to Shanghai, her daily life is almost full of shopping, drinking tea, and beauty care.In fact, when she first returned to China to look for a job, Li Man received two good offers from two well-known foreign banks with a monthly salary of more than 6,000, but she did not accept them. "Isn't it only 6,000 yuan a month? I can't make money by doing whatever I want. I have to look at other people's faces when I go to work. Besides, I studied early and I am still young. I should play more while I am young." Li Man has his own life. logic. At this moment, she was sitting opposite Xiao Zhengyi, and asked with a smile, "Then will you buy a set for me?" This is a straightforward question. In Xiao Zhengyi's view, it is tantamount to "Then will you marry me?"If you do not have a certain economic strength in Shanghai Beach, it is like being in a primeval forest, but you do not have the ability to hunt and avoid being hunted. The effects of the two are the same.This is a reminder to Xiao Zhengyi from friends around him. Since it would be so "dangerous" to be without money in this city, why wouldn't it be wrong for my future wife to ask my husband to use money to build her a safe fortress? Looking at this pretty girl who is persistently looking for answers, Xiao Zhengyi, who is exhausted between blind dates and work, finally decides to seriously try a relationship, with marriage as the premise. So, he promised Li Man that there would be a house. However, Xiao Zhengyi, who has lived in Germany for many years, is not really aware of the turbulent Shanghai property market. In 2009, the average house price in the urban area of ​​Berlin was 1500-2000 euros per square meter.Buying a new house of 80 square meters in a prosperous area of ​​the city center costs between 150,000 and 200,000 euros, and a second-hand house is about 100,000 to 150,000 euros.If you don’t care about the location, there are many second-hand houses of about 60 square meters in the suburbs 30 minutes away from the center of Berlin, with prices ranging from 50,000 to 80,000 euros. Moreover, this price has not changed in almost ten years.In the past ten years, housing prices in Germany have remained at a low level. The nominal housing prices in Germany have only increased by 1% per year, while the average annual price level in Germany has increased by 2%. % speed reduction. Compared with the ever-changing housing prices in first-tier cities such as Beijing and Shanghai, this price really seems a bit "shabby".Especially in Shanghai, in 2009, the average transaction price of No. 1 Xinhua Road in Changning Inner Ring was 79,000 per square meter, which was nearly five times that of Berlin’s city center based on exchange rate conversion. Then look at per capita income.The per capita monthly income in Berlin in 2009 was about 2,400 euros, basically the same as the housing prices in the city center.After all, buying a decent house in Berlin is equivalent to 5 to 8 years' wages of ordinary people.However, according to Liman's principle of buying houses not in prime locations, not in high-end residential areas, and not in large houses, even if you buy a 150-square-meter apartment in the urban area with an average price of 50,000 yuan per square meter, with Xiao Zhengyi's annual salary of 500,000 yuan, you still need to buy a house. It takes 15 years of struggle without eating or drinking to be satisfied. After a little calculation of the account, Xiao Zhengyi felt that this city was too absurd. Since he had invested all his savings in starting a business before, Xiao Zhengyi had nothing left except his part-time salary.Because of the fear of being a house slave, and because I am afraid that if I spend most of my life supporting a mansion, I will end up with a house but no people. It is bitter to think about it.Therefore, Xiao Zhengyi and Li Man discussed the matter of the house for a while, to see if the house price might fall, after all, the state regulates round after round. Li Man said yes.However, correspondingly, the matter of marriage should be delayed. The house and marriage have been slowed down, but such an important matter as spending money cannot be delayed.Li Man always asked Xiao Zhengyi for gifts every now and then. She never said it clearly. She just mentioned with a smile during the date that she had recently taken a fancy to a silk scarf from Hermès, a camellia brooch from Chanel, or a bag from LV, but she casually said that she couldn’t bear it. Buy, "Huo Lingzi" (Shanghai dialect, implied meaning) to Xiao Zhengyi.The next time Xiao asked her out again, Li Man would use all kinds of excuses to refuse to go to the appointment, until Xiao Zhengyi "received the Lingzi" (understanding the hint, it is commonly known as "the son with eyesight" by the northerners) bought a gift and delivered it to the door. Li Man agrees with his mother's point of view: when a man loves a woman, he can't just talk about it.The most practical thing is to spend money for women. First, the money is earned by a man with his brain, body and energy. If he is willing to spend it for you, it proves that he cares about you. Second, the amount of money he earns is a proof of a man’s ability. , he must not only have a heart, but also have the ability to take care of women, otherwise don't mention love, because he simply "can't afford to love". Li Man grew up in the Shikumen behind Jing'an Temple. The house was dark and damp. The wooden stairs were steep and narrow, and they creaked when they stepped on them. The stairwells often smelled of sweat, mold and cat urine. A family of three squeezed into more than ten square meters, and the kitchen and bathroom were shared by three families.The area where their home is located is the most prosperous area in Jing'an District, and it is also one of the most luxurious business circles in Shanghai.Next to the golden Jing'an Temple, next to Jiuguang Department Store, which is famous for its high-end consumption, there is an extremely ordinary windbreaker in it. This contrast is shocking.Li Man knew very well since she was a child that good things have to be bought with money. Without money, she can only stay forever in the old Shikumen that smells like cat urine. Once, Li Man's father passed by Jiuguang Department Store and felt thirsty, so he bought two big snow-white pears in the supermarket below.Because all the shopping carts around were foreigners or well-dressed Chinese, Li Man's father didn't want to be ashamed, so he didn't look at the prices carefully, and walked straight to the cashier with two pears.When I checked out, it was more than 50 yuan, just two pears?Father guards the door in the community, and it costs fifty yuan a day to guard it.But he gritted his teeth and bought it. When he got home, he ate the pears carefully, even chewing the pears. However, even though his family was in a difficult situation, Li Man was never treated badly.When she was in junior high school, her mother bought a gold necklace for her as a birthday present, saying: "other people's daughters are not as good-looking as my daughter-in-law. They wear gold and silver, and my daughter-in-law doesn't have one, so it's too sinful (poor meaning)." For this reason, their family ate green vegetables for more than three months. Li Man has a aunt who is beautiful and married twice. The second husband is a hairy Italian who runs a business in Shanghai.Auntie often drives her Porsche and carries a Gucci bag to visit Li Man's house, showing off her recent shopping trophies one by one.Li Man stared straight at her eyes, but every time her mother saw this younger sister who had become a "rich wife", she panicked in her heart.She herself failed to marry a rich man, so she hoped that her daughter could fly out of the grass nest and climb high branches. So, just after three or four semesters in Liman University, my mother solemnly announced at a gathering of relatives and friends: Allah is going to start looking for a husband for my daughter!Please broaden your thinking and put it into action, so that your mind can be liberated, your steps can be bigger, and your heart can be warmer. The mother is very persistent. She thinks that finding a son-in-law is like picking apples. You have to act early and decisively. There are only a few good apples. If you doze off for a while, they will be picked out with quick eyesight. In fact, the main reason is that Shanghai is a very “crazy” city, which changes drastically every day and every three days. When the gate is opened, all good things rush in, the ecology is immediately unbalanced, and people’s hearts are suddenly agitated.There is nothing wrong with living a better life, but how can we live better without money?As a result, love turned sour in this city. Later, the mother had the cheek to ask the "Mrs. Rich" sister for help, and borrowed money to send Li Man to study in the UK, and gilded her daughter, so as to have a good social status and a good starting point. When looking for a job after returning to China, Li Man had a deeper recognition of his mother's words.If she relied on her own salary, how many years would it take to buy a decent house?She should still marry a rich man, so that she can live a good life soon. When she is rich, her parents don't have to work so hard. Therefore, in order to test Xiao Zhengyi's financial strength, Li Man set a date at Hang Lung Plaza, pointed to a diamond ring worth more than 200,000 yuan in the Cartier counter, and said that he hoped to get this gift. The honest Xiao Zhengyi misinterpreted it as Li Man agreeing to get married.So he swiped his gold card and bought a diamond ring immediately, and proposed to Li Man.Li Man happily put on the ring, but rejected his marriage proposal.This made Xiao Zhengyi a little angry. But the next day, Li Man's gentle voice came over the phone again. She said that marriage is fine, but without a roof of her own to shelter her from wind and rain, she would lose confidence in her new life and the courage to step into it. Another house.Xiao Zhengyi held the phone and smiled wryly. At this time, the time has entered September 2010. In the 20 weeks since the last round of state regulation on real estate was launched, Shanghai housing prices have reached a new high. Another "milestone". On September 8, the E18 plot along the Huangpu River became the most expensive residential land in the country with a transaction price of 35,480 yuan per square meter.According to the latest data provided by Fangfang Real Estate Consulting Agency, in the first eight months of 2010 in Shanghai, the proportion of residential land with a transaction price of less than 10,000 yuan has dropped from 76.9% of the total in 2009 to 51.91% this year ( "Daily Economic News"). The sharp reduction in the number of land plots with a floor price of less than 10,000 yuan means that in the next two to three years, about 50% of Shanghai home buyers will be "luxury houses".If the floor price reaches more than 10,000 yuan/square meter, the house will sell for at least 30,000 yuan/square meter after completion. Gemdale Corporation once publicly disclosed that it wanted to build a luxury house, and its target was the king of Shanghai’s suburban land won at 14,500 yuan/square meter in Zhaoxiang Town, Qingpu, Shanghai. At that time, industry insiders estimated that the price of the project might reach 30,000 yuan/square meter, but from The latest estimate of the market is that the selling price of the above-mentioned projects may reach 70,000 yuan/square meter. The more the price is adjusted, the higher the housing price, the land kings are refreshed frequently, and the high-priced land is dedicated to building luxury houses. It became a financial transaction—whether it was a house or a wife, they couldn't afford to "buy" because they were all in Shanghai.Xiao Zhengyi had to re-examine his life and his position in the city.Shanghai, is there a future for me? In fact, based on Xiao Zhengyi's current income, it is not impossible to support a full-time wife and live in a mansion that belongs to his own property, as long as he is willing to borrow money and work hard to fill these two "black holes". Work alive.But what about his ideals?How did his entrepreneurial dreams end?Letting Shanghai transform himself into a middle-aged man who purely pursues material things is not the ending that Xiao Zhengyi wants. He and Li Man broke up.The values ​​​​of the two people are completely different, and neither can convince the other.He hopes that his future wife is considerate and capable, not just a credit card machine; she thinks that a man should use money to prove that he has the ability to build a safe and comfortable home, especially in such a treacherous city where money is paramount. On the day they broke up, the two had a big fight in the parking lot of the Metro Building in Xujiahui.Xiao Zhengyi's Audi A6 was parked in the aisle, and inside the car, the two had a heated argument.Xiao Zhengyi used Nanjing dialect to detail Li Man's many shortcomings, while Li Man used standard Shanghai dialect to ridicule Xiao Zhengyi's "incompetence". A Chery QQ3 behind was blocked by Xiao Zhengyi's car, unable to get out, and honked its horn angrily.Sitting in the car were Ou Zhenhua and his wife Wang Xiaoling, who was six months pregnant. Today he accompanied her to resign. Now that the work has been completed, they are in a hurry to meet with the agency. The two are listed in Huaqiao, Kunshan. The small duplex house for sale is said to have found a buyer. "Beat Mossa in front (Hubei dialect, meaning what)?" Wang Xiaoling frowned, looking through the window glass at the Audi that was stuck in the middle of the road ahead, "The parking fee is 10 yuan an hour, they don't do you know?" Wang Xiaoling settles accounts in her heart almost every day. In 2010, the monthly parking fee in Shanghai was US$278.73, ranking 38th in the world, an increase of nearly 27% compared to 2009.The parking lot of the Metro Building is at an upper-middle level. In principle, it is not open to the public. It is billed on time at 15 yuan for the first hour, and 10 yuan per hour after the hour. Internal employees can apply for a monthly parking card, and the fee is 2,500 yuan per month. Yuan.For Wang Xiaoling, who earns a monthly salary of more than 8,000 yuan, it is still a lot of expenses. If it is not because more than a year ago, she bought a house in Huaqiao at an unimaginable cheap price of 2,800 yuan/square meter in the urban area of ​​Shanghai, and the commute is far away. , she is not willing to spend 35% of her monthly salary just to park a car. So, Ou Zhenhua got out of the car, and quickly stepped forward to knock on the glass of the other party's car. Xiao Zhengyi was a computer student, and it was the first time he got out of control like this. He apologized to the people who came, and quickly drove the car out of the parking lot.A week later, Xiao Zhengyi received an invitation to start a business from a college classmate. The other party was planning to establish an industrial robot development and industrialization base in Nanjing, forming a geographical "north-south echo" with Shenyang's "Xinsong" robot.He likes Xiao Zhengyi's professional skills and entrepreneurial experience, so he hopes that his former classmates can help him to start a business together. Compared with Shanghai, Nanjing also has rich scientific and educational resources, and its labor cost is lower than Shanghai. Moreover, the Nanjing municipal government has introduced more favorable policies in terms of housing policies, welfare guarantees, and venture capital for overseas returnees to start businesses. Why did I insist on staying in Shanghai as a "phoenix tail", but never thought of developing in a more profitable city?Why should I be wronged to endure the high cost of Shanghai, but I didn't expect to go out and find hope in other cities?After asking such a question, Xiao Zhengyi immediately felt awakened.He immediately packed up, resigned, returned the rented house, and drove all the way north.Leaving Shanghai, went to Nanjing.If you see the news that the industrial robot industry is booming in Nanjing, it must be the result of Xiao Zhengyi's hard work after starting again. Speaking of starting again, this is also the wish of Ou Zhenhua and Wang Xiaoling.The day Xiao Zhengyi left Shanghai was also the day the post-80s couple returned to Wuhan. After graduating from Wuhan University in 2004, they broke into Shanghai together. Ou Zhenhua and Wang Xiaoling were interested in the development prospects of the Japanese major here.From 300 yuan/month to rent a "half room" to 1,800 yuan/month to rent a fully furnished unit; from two ordinary employees of foreign companies to an annual salary of 200,000... In 2007, they felt that they should buy a house . They can't "eat the old", and they don't have much savings, so they can only buy a house with a down payment of no more than 100,000 and a full price of about 300,000.At that time, the housing prices of Jiuting and Jiangqiao in the outer ring were close to 8,000 yuan per square meter.The company subsidized the car, so the two bought a small duplex house in Huaqiao with a loan of 2,800 yuan per square meter. The total price of the house was 350,000 yuan, and it was exactly 35 kilometers away from the city center. The house is located at the junction of Shanghai Qingpu, Jiading and Jiangsu Kunshan. The mobile phone signal is very messy. One is "Shanghai Mobile welcomes you" and the other is "Jiangsu Mobile welcomes you". One house can have two area codes of 0512 and 021 at the same time landline phone. But the really bad thing is that Wang Xiaoling didn't know until she was pregnant in early 2010 that Huaqiao belonged to Kunshan, and the baby could not apply for Shanghai household registration after the baby was born.The couple was in a hurry, and it didn't matter if they were struggling, "You must not blackmail the child!" Therefore, when the regulation was tightened in the first half of 2010 and the housing market was at a low ebb, the two gritted their teeth again and bought Jiading Anting Huangdu with a loan. small room.The two mortgages put the couple out of breath. When I think about it in the dead of night, I feel that the future life is as unpredictable as the night in front of me. "Few people will flee Shanghai for one reason, but in the end there will always be one thing that makes you leave firmly." Wang Xiaoling can't forget the hard work she used to do. "I spend more time with clients than with my family. After a project starts, I have to work around the clock. I talk to my husband less than 10 sentences a day, and 9 and a half of them are "orders." ' or 'arrangement of work' - because they often take their work emotions home, and even vent their anger. Even when they take a vacation, they always answer the boss's calls with their mobile phones." Once the work stops, she immediately loses herself . Recently, Wang Xiaoling has been reviewing her MBA at home, preparing to take the exam after giving birth.Ou Zhenhua was hired by a large state-owned enterprise in Wuhan by virtue of his academic qualifications and work experience in Shanghai, and his salary was comparable to that in Shanghai.Wang Xiaoling believes that her future job will not be worse than her husband's. They dealt with the house in Shanghai and officially settled their home in Wuhan, and they didn't need a loan to buy a house.The new home of the two is located near the "Optics Valley" in Wuhan, a place where the industry development is similar to Zhangjiang, and the commercial prosperity is similar to Hongqiao.The house is the best townhouse in Wuhan, and it is only more than 10,000 yuan per square meter. I have my own car, and my life is very comfortable.The key is that you will no longer be stuck in road traffic, you will no longer pay expensive parking fees, you will not be squeezed into meat pies even if you take the subway, and the cost of living will be greatly reduced.Every year, I have some spare money on hand, and I can also travel, or start a business on my own. In fact, Wang Xiaoling doesn't dislike Shanghai, and even likes the 24-hour convenience stores that can be found everywhere in this city.However, she believes that Shanghai is too expensive, and the high cost of living seriously exploits the people in the city. The couple settle accounts and earn money every day. This has become the whole life, and there is no other pursuit in life.If this is the so-called good life in the city, then she would rather give up everything and start from scratch.Of course, it takes courage, so she is proud of the two people's final decision to "leave Shanghai". In Shanghai, Xiao Zhengyi's entrepreneurial dream was trapped by funds, and his love was defeated by material things.In fact, as far as the entrepreneurial dilemma is concerned, he is not alone in his distress.According to a Hong Kong "Wen Wei Po" report in 2004: Shanghai returnee companies have hidden worries, "less than 25% of them are profitable, 30% of the companies are in the seed stage or laboratory stage of start-ups, 65% are in the founding stage, and only 5% of the companies Entering the mature stage. Therefore, most returnee enterprises are in the initial investment stage or loss-making stage.” The reasons include the following two points: 1. Financing difficulties.Among the returnees, 43.4% think that the biggest difficulty after returning to China is "no funds". The threshold for applying for venture capital funds in China is high, the procedures are cumbersome, and the success rate is low; cash.According to reports, some district government departments are very enthusiastic when the returnee enterprises want to settle down, promising various preferential policies. When the enterprises are put into production, many promises are often not fulfilled. The consequences of such a situation are also not optimistic. In February 2010, the results of the general report of the research project "The Situation of Returned Overseas Students Coming to Shanghai for Work and Entrepreneurship" conducted by the Shanghai European and American Scholars Association showed that the number of overseas returnees coming to Shanghai to start businesses has been decreasing year by year.As of February 2010, more than 4,400 enterprises have been established in Shanghai by returned overseas students, with a total investment of more than 550 million US dollars.However, from the analysis of the development trend, the number of overseas students' entrepreneurial qualifications has dropped from 274 in 2004 to 61 in 2008, showing a downward trend year by year.In other words, fewer and fewer returnees are willing to start businesses in Shanghai. American psychologist Abraham Maslow divided human needs into five categories, from low-level to high-level, in turn: physiological needs, safety needs, social needs, esteem needs, and self-actualization needs.He believes that people are always trying to satisfy a certain need, and once one need is satisfied, another need will take its place.In general, higher-level needs will not be energetic enough to drive behavior until lower-level needs are satisfied. In fact, to put it simply, if you have to work hard every day for food, clothing, housing, and transportation, you will not pay attention to such trivial things as frequent unilateral nasal congestion, which may be a precursor to nasal cancer; if you save a few dollars every day If you walk for more than 20 minutes for the fare, you will hesitate to choose a boyfriend with an annual salary of 50,000 or 500,000. This choice has nothing to do with love; Will you spend three hours a day practicing piano or sketching, just for hobbies like when you were a child? Japanese literati refer to Shanghai as the "Magic City". Although this is a remark against a specific historical background, it is of practical significance.Shanghai is such a magical city, she can put the world's most dazzling material enjoyment in front of you - want to take it?pay me.Give youth and ideals, health and fun. Therefore, people come and go, going in and out of this city, just because their value balance is tilting, just like the choice of Xiao Zhengyi, the expensive Shanghai hinders the realization of ideals and the pursuit of a better life, leaving What's the point?With your ability, you can easily obtain a house and a car in other cities, but you will have to fight for it all your life when you arrive in Shanghai, which will make you lose energy and financial resources to do other things you like or fulfill more important wishes. In this case, How attractive is Shanghai to you?Are you sure you really understand Shanghai and how expensive this oriental "magic capital" is?
